由明矾和胶料配制而成的胶矾水,是书画绘制、装裱和修复过程中经常使用的材料。胶矾水具有防腐、固色和增加机械力度等功能,但对纸质文物的耐久性有一定的影响。本研究选用宣纸、桑皮纸和连史纸等代表性的传统手工制纸,在它们的表面分别涂敷不同浓度的胶矾水,经干热老化后,对比分析它们的酸碱度、白度、耐折度和抗张强度的变化,揭示胶矾水对这几种手工纸张性能的影响,进而探讨其影响机理。研究结果表明,胶矾水将增加纸张的酸度、降低纸张的白度,明胶水能提升纸张的机械强度,而不同浓度明矾对纸张机械强度的影响存在差异。  相似文献

Few writers, medieval or modern, have had much good to write about William Rufus, the second Norman king of England (1087–1100). Beginning in the twelfth century, chroniclers and historians have portrayed William as a cruel, grasping, and sacriligious ruler. This study traces the development of this unflattering historical image from the twelfth to the eighteenth centuries and notes that the religious convictions which encouraged medieval churchmen to condemn Rufus were offset in the sixteenth and seventeenth centuries by a more political and anti-catholic approach to his reign. Beginning in the eighteenth century, however, historians abandoned this more flattering portrayal and returned once again to the evil image concocted by the monastic chroniclers.  相似文献

明矾是我国传统书画修复装裱中一种极其重要的材料,但明矾水解析出酸,会促使纸张纤维素发生酸性水解。研究对比了明矾和水解后具有高阳离子电荷的6种沉淀剂对宣纸施胶前后的pH值、疏水性、色差、力学性能变化和对国画颜料的固色效果,利用扫描电镜(SEM)和衰减全反射傅里叶变换红外光谱(ATR-FTIR)测试宣纸施胶后的化学键合状况(包括沉淀剂与胶料、纤维),结合高场~(27)Al核磁共振波谱(~(27)Al-NMR)测试了纸张施胶中铝盐沉淀剂的水解聚合形态,及其与胶料混合后对宣纸表面化学形态变化的影响。结果表明,白色聚合氯化铝(PAC)施胶宣纸pH值可达到7以上,作为沉淀剂的施胶液处理后的宣纸具有一定的疏水性,湿热老化过程中具有较高的耐折度和抗张强度,色差变化小,对颜料固色效果好。SEM分析表明,白色PAC可使胶料分布较均匀,能在一定程度上包覆、填充宣纸纤维和孔隙。~(27)Al-NMR、ATR-FTIR及固化性能分析表明,PAC多核铝[AlO_4Al_(12)(OH)_(24)(H_2O)_(12)]~(7+)(Al_(13))含量相对较高,对明胶也具有促干剂作用,可和胶料产生键合,形成网状络合物,适合替代明矾作为施胶沉淀剂。  相似文献

This article publishes a document from the archives of the Order of Saint John recording the Hospitallers’ concession of an alum exploration and mining monopoly, an appalto, to a group of Florentines in 1442, and examines the implications of this agreement for the economic development of the Latin East in this period. This enterprise forms part of a pattern showing Florentine merchants attempting to extend their activities further up the alum supply chain and so to gain increasing control over a commodity of vital importance to their city’s economy, for which they had been dependent on the Genoese who dominated the trade. This development in turn forms part of a wider fifteenth-century trend of the Florentines interloping in areas of activity previously the preserve of other communities, principally the Venetians and Genoese, with a long-established maritime, territorial, diplomatic and commercial position in the eastern Mediterranean. It also forms part of a pattern of new speculative alum mining enterprises in the Aegean in the mid-fifteenth century, calling into question the traditional view that the alum trade was afflicted by a glut at this time, and thus also the traditional explanation of the ensuing consolidation of alum firms. The article also compares this document with a previously published contract issued the preceding year, concluding that the differences between them reflect the developing familiarity of the Hospitaller leadership with the mining business, while their common characteristics confirm the currency of the term appalto in the mining business of this period as denoting a monopoly. It tentatively concludes that this effort to establish an alum mining industry in Hospitaller territory was probably ultimately unsuccessful.  相似文献

This work characterizes both tanning and colouring materials found in ancient Egyptian leather objects from the Metropolitan Museum of Art. The analytical investigations focused on assessing the development of the technology of ancient tanners using high‐performance liquid chromatography (HPLC), surface‐enhanced Raman spectroscopy (SERS), X‐ray fluorescence (XRF), Fourier transform infrared spectroscopy (FT–IR), X‐ray radiography and a scanning electron microscope connected to an energy‐dispersive X‐ray detector (SEM–EDX). Reference leather samples and archaeological leather objects were investigated to identify the animal skin species and the early use of hydrolyzable vegetable tannins for leather tanning. Different methods were used to colour th leather, including madder dying and staining with hematite, or painting with Egyptian blue and Egyptian green.  相似文献
